Clare can take a huge step toward securing a spot in the Munster hurling final this afternoon.
Brian Lohan’s side welcome Davy Fitzgerald’s Waterford to Cusack Park, with the Banner hoping to record their second of the campaign.
Clare have made one change to their side from the starting 15 that beat Cork, with Darragh Lohan coming in at midfield.
Shane O’Donnell lines out at full forward and the Eire Óg clubman says the home support will be vital in helping them over the line

There is a 4pm start in Semple Stadium as Tipperary host Cork.
Victory for the Rebels would see Tipp eliminated from the championship
